Nightly reindex — Quillsearch 3.x. Heads up, plugin folks: the reindex kicks off at 02:10 server time and rebuilds the Lanternbay document shards from scratch. If your plugin injects custom analyzers, make sure they're registered before the job starts, or your fields get dropped silently (yes, silently — sorry). Once the reindex finishes, the job publishes a signed manifest so downstream plugins can verify the shard set. Validate the manifest with this key.

signing key of hahag-tahag = bky4_v18e

**Ticket: MarkFlow config drift in plugin sandbox**

Hey plugin folks — heads up that the MarkFlow rendering pipeline's sandbox settings have drifted from what our docs claim. Some of you are seeing footnotes render differently between staging and prod. We traced it to an unsynced override pushed by the Quillbank team. The current effective values are listed below.

deployment values, yahag-tawef:
ZORWYN_HOST=zorwyn.tolvaqlabs.internal
ZORWYN_PORT=9300

**Ticket: Staging env misconfigured for profile-store sharding**

The Lanternmoth user-profile store was recently split into eight shards, but staging still points all traffic at shard zero, which is why support is seeing stale profile reads. Please verify the shard map version and ring size in staging's env file before rerouting. The shard router also authenticates to the ring coordinator, and its credential must appear on the very next line.

vault entry, yahif-yajep: COURIER_KEY29=b802bdf8034096b65a51c6ba5abe2

Subject: DR drill moved (again) — calendar sync being weird

Hey future maintainers,

The Bramblewick failover drill got double-booked because Pinloft calendar sync duplicated the invite across two regions' schedules. We're keeping the Thursday slot; ignore the Tuesday ghost event. If the sync daemon fights you, just restart it before the drill. To unlock the standby vault during the exercise, use the passphrase below.

vault phrase of yagag-kadup = belael-druius-rusax-kelox